What Exactly is THCA?
Understanding THCA, or tetrahydrocannabinolic acid, is key to recognizing cannabis’s full therapeutic potential. This non-intoxicating precursor compound, abundant in raw and live cannabis plants, does not produce a psychoactive “high.” Instead, it is studied for its anti-inflammatory and neuroprotective properties. When heated through a process called decarboxylation, THCA converts into the well-known psychoactive compound, THC. This distinction highlights the importance of **cannabinoid science and research** in developing targeted wellness applications from the raw plant material.

Maximizing Your Experience with Concentrates
Maximizing your experience with concentrates begins with proper equipment. A high-quality, temperature-controlled dab rig or a specialized vaporizer is essential for preserving delicate terpenes and cannabinoids. Low-temperature dabbing is a key technique, as it unlocks superior flavor and provides a smoother inhalation.
Starting with a very small dose is the most crucial rule for both safety and enjoyment, allowing you to gauge potency effectively.
Always store your extracts in a cool, dark place to maintain their integrity. This mindful approach ensures a refined and controlled session, elevating your appreciation for these potent products.
